javax.ejb
Class ScheduleExpression
java.lang.Object
javax.ejb.ScheduleExpression
- All Implemented Interfaces:
- java.io.Serializable
public final class ScheduleExpression
- extends java.lang.Object
- implements java.io.Serializable
A calendar-based timeout expression for an enterprise bean timer.
See the Schedule annotation for the defaults.
- Since:
- 3.1
- See Also:
- Serialized Form
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ScheduleExpression
public ScheduleExpression()
dayOfMonth
public ScheduleExpression dayOfMonth(int d)
dayOfMonth
public ScheduleExpression dayOfMonth(java.lang.String d)
dayOfWeek
public ScheduleExpression dayOfWeek(int d)
dayOfWeek
public ScheduleExpression dayOfWeek(java.lang.String d)
end
public ScheduleExpression end(java.util.Date e)
getDayOfMonth
public java.lang.String getDayOfMonth()
getDayOfWeek
public java.lang.String getDayOfWeek()
getEnd
public java.util.Date getEnd()
getHour
public java.lang.String getHour()
getMinute
public java.lang.String getMinute()
getMonth
public java.lang.String getMonth()
getSecond
public java.lang.String getSecond()
getStart
public java.util.Date getStart()
getYear
public java.lang.String getYear()
hour
public ScheduleExpression hour(int h)
hour
public ScheduleExpression hour(java.lang.String h)
minute
public ScheduleExpression minute(int m)
minute
public ScheduleExpression minute(java.lang.String m)
month
public ScheduleExpression month(int m)
month
public ScheduleExpression month(java.lang.String m)
second
public ScheduleExpression second(int s)
second
public ScheduleExpression second(java.lang.String s)
start
public ScheduleExpression start(java.util.Date s)
year
public ScheduleExpression year(int y)
year
public ScheduleExpression year(java.lang.String y)